The Magic City Discovery Center will be closing its doors after a third temporary season.
Right now the discovery center shares the building with the Dakota Territory Air Museum which means the center can only be open for a few months.
Board members are working towards expanding their space and being at a location where discoveries could be made year round.
The treasurer told me that it’s so exciting to see the light bulb go off when the kids get it and learn something new.
The goal for the future is to have the children’s museum become a destination spot for the community and visitors.
She added that having them do new activities makes them excited to learn and could possibly spark an interest.
“Not only is it absolutely educational, always fun of course it’s fun but it really has an economic impact too.” said Wendy Keller.
The discovery center will be closing this weekend but before they do, the musical Busytown will be performed by Make A Scene Kids.
There is a show tonight, tomorrow, and then it will close the season on Sunday afternoon.
